Transaction 56784cc55d93fe63a7688373a071c3c513808bcc38faa230e020f8dfa64e2fa2

1 Input
2 Outputs
  • 56784cc55d93fe63a7688373a071c3c513808bcc38faa230e020f8dfa64e2fa2:0
  • value  819772
    address  14amXMDCehqszdTFv36cy19qFNd31tYncV
  • 56784cc55d93fe63a7688373a071c3c513808bcc38faa230e020f8dfa64e2fa2:1
  • value  4300000
    address  32Hq3WkrGu6RMJGrVgy3gfY31QMUCfRwAd